Support Senate Bill 2495

I am speaking on behalf of children in foster care with Catholic Charities and Catholic Social Services. I would like to respectfully urge Illinois legislators to find a fair resolution to the dispute over the interpretation of the Illinois Religious Freedom Protection and Civil Union Act. Catholic Social Services (CSS) is a valuable resource for families in need.

Illinois Senator Kyle McCarter has introduced new legislation, SB 2495, which would allow faith based agencies to refer civil union couples to other child welfare agencies for services. This legislation would;
• Protect religious liberties afforded under the Illinois Constitution and the U.S. Constitution (note that civil union couples will continue to be able to adopt and be in the foster care system even if our religious liberties are protected).
• Allow faith-based agencies to continue to provide efficient and quality care to the most vulnerable children in our state.
• Respect the long-standing and effective public/private partnership between DCFS and faith-based organizations.
• Continue to preserves the separation of church and state by ensuring that religious denominations are not forced to act in discordance with their religious doctrines.

CSS helps foster children heal from the trauma of abuse and neglect, helps families resolve problems that led to placement, and encourages lasting family relationships for all children. Without your help and support, 2,000 children and families will face unnecessary disruption of their services and relationships with helping professionals. These types of disruptions can delay permanency, set a child back clinically, and threaten placement stability. There is no reason to risk such a disruption. A solution can and should be found that protects the rights of all Illinois citizens.

Supporting this legislation will ensure the stability, well-being, and best interest of the children as well as respecting the rights of all parties involved.
